No question - The Speedo Fastskin
Don't even think of using a non-swimming type of wetsuit for a triathlon.

If you want to use a wet suit - call around to different running/triathlon shops in your area and ask about renting a wet suit. Fleetfeet near me will rent Ironman Stealth and Instinct wet suits for like $18.00. They offer both Longjohn and Full styles - Choosing to rent allows you to try different sizes and types of wet suits prior to spending the big $$ to buy your own. However, make sure you reserve it way ahead of time prior to your Triathlon or you will find them all reserved by other triathletes.
